INGREDIENTS
2 cup orange sherbert
2ΒΌ cup lowfat milk
2 cup lemon sherbert
3 drops yellow food coloring
2 cup lime sherbert
2 drops green food coloring
3 cup rasberry sherbert
1 fruit for garnish
Place 6 16oz glasses on angle into 2 standard size loaf pan. In blender, combine orange sherbert & 1/2 cup milk, blend until smooth but still thick. Carefully spoon about 1/3 cup of mixture into each glass, being careful not to get any drips on the side of glasses. Transfer loaf pans to freezer.
Freeze glasses 1 hr until sherbert is firm. Combine lemon sherbert, 1/2 cup milk & yellow food coloring. Blend until smooth but thick. Spoon 1/3 mixture into frozen slanted glasses. Freeze 1 hr till firm. Repeat same process for lime color, 1/2 c milk & green food coloring. Add to glass, freeze 1 hr
. Combine rasberry sherbert & 3/4 c milk. Blend till smooth but thick. Place tilted glasses upright, fill with 1/3 mixture. Freeze 1 hr or overnight. Garnish with fruit if desired.
